Abstract

Object-oriented model is based on some rationales of software engineering,whereas relational database schema is based on mathematical rationales.The difference between the two foundations causes the imperfect fit between them.Object/Relational Mapping provides a bridge between them.This article introduce the Persistence Layer and Mapping.The application of NHibernate in.NET Framework are especially introduced.
